ABOUT HERMAN VAN VEEN
Herman van Veen (1945) grew up in Utrecht where he also attended the conservatory. Since then he has traveled around the world with his performances. To this day his work has resulted in more than one hundred and eighty CDs, eighty books and about five hundred paintings.
He has been honored numerous times for both his artistic work and his dedication to projects for peace, security and solidarity. Among other things, he is a bearer of the Verdienstkreuz am Band des Verdienstordens der Bundesrepublik Deutschland, Ridder in de Orde van Oranje Nassau and Ridder in de Orde van de Nederlandse Leeuw. He has an Honorary Doctorate from the Free University of Brussels. From the Club of Budapest he received the Planetary Consciousness Award. In France Le Grand Prix de l'Académie Charles Cros de Littérature Musicale. And in Cuxhaven Germany, June 2021, the Joachim Ringelnatz Literatur Preis.
Herman is father of four children and stepfather to the Alfred Jodocus Kwak.
He is grandfather to three grandchildren.
